Since version 0.9.0, RPC mode (--mode rpc) was not saving messages to
session files. The agent.subscribe() call with session management logic
was only present in the TUI renderer after it was refactored.
RPC mode now properly saves sessions just like interactive mode.
Added test for RPC mode session management to prevent regression.

Add grep, find, and ls tools for safe code exploration without modification risk.
These tools are available via the new --tools CLI flag.
- grep: Uses ripgrep (auto-downloaded) for fast regex searching. Respects .gitignore,
supports glob filtering, context lines, and hidden files.
- find: Uses fd (auto-downloaded) for fast file finding. Respects .gitignore, supports
glob patterns, and hidden files.
- ls: Lists directory contents with proper sorting and directory indicators.
- --tools flag: Specify available tools (e.g., --tools read,grep,find,ls for read-only mode)
- Dynamic system prompt adapts to selected tools with relevant guidelines

- Replace slow synchronous directory walking with fd for fuzzy file search
- Auto-download fd to ~/.pi/agent/tools/ if not found in PATH
- Performance improved from ~900ms to ~10ms per keystroke on large repos
- Remove minimatch dependency from tui package
- Graceful degradation if fd unavailable (empty results)

Implements ability to include files directly in the initial message using @ prefix.
Features:
- All @file arguments are coalesced into the first user message
- Text files wrapped in <file name="path">content</file> tags
- Images (.jpg, .jpeg, .png, .gif, .webp) attached as base64-encoded attachments
- Supports ~ expansion, relative and absolute paths
- Empty files are skipped silently
- Non-existent files cause immediate error with clear message
- Works in interactive, --print, and --mode text/json modes
- Not supported in --mode rpc (errors with clear message)
Examples:
pi @prompt.md @image.png "Do this"
pi --print @code.ts "Review this code"
pi @requirements.md @design.png "Implement this"

Session reconstruction only needs:
- type: 'session' - session metadata
- type: 'message' - conversation history
- type: 'thinking_level_change' - thinking level changes
- type: 'model_change' - model changes
Events like agent_start/end, tool_execution_start/end are not needed for
session reconstruction and only added bloat. This reduces session file size
significantly and speeds up writes.

Session manager changes:
- Add ThinkingLevelChangeEntry and ModelChangeEntry types
- Add saveThinkingLevelChange() and saveModelChange() methods
- Update loadThinkingLevel() to also check for thinking_level_change events
(not just session headers)
TUI changes:
- Pass SessionManager to TuiRenderer constructor
- Call saveThinkingLevelChange() when user changes thinking level via /thinking
- Store session manager as instance variable for future use
This ensures thinking level changes during a session are persisted
and correctly restored on --continue.
